How much do remote net develop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ote net developer in Coppell, TX is $49.60,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42.84 and $56.59 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Remote Net Developer vs Remote Software Developer?

AspectRemote Net DeveloperRemote Software Developer
Required CredentialsTypically requires a Microsoft Certified: .NET Developer or similar certificationOften requires a degree in Computer Science or related field; certifications vary
Work EnvironmentPrimarily works on Windows-based environments developing .NET applicationsWorks across various platforms, including web, mobile, and desktop applications
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in enterprise, finance, and healthcare sectors using Microsoft technologiesUsed across tech startups, software firms, and diverse industries

Remote Net Developers focus on building applications using Microsoft .NET technologies, often in enterprise settings. Remote Software Developers have a broader scope, working on various platforms and languages. Both roles are remote-friendly but differ in technical focus and industry application.

Job description

Set the technical direction for how arrivia builds with AI agents, architecting systems and raising the engineering bar across teams.
As a Senior Agentic Software Engineer, you are a product-minded, full-stack engineer who ships faster and smarter with AI coding agents as core development tools. Operating with limited oversight and broad organizational scope, you architect systems, set technical direction, and drive engineering standards across teams.
This role helps shape the technology foundation behind arrivia, a leader in travel loyalty, membership, and cruise solutions, powering travel for millions of members.
You will make high-impact architectural and strategic decisions that shape the platform's foundation, weighing innovation, risk, scalability, and business impact. You lead by example, mentoring engineers across teams and influencing technology investment decisions.
You will shape how the whole organization adopts agentic development, defining the patterns, prompt libraries, and MCP integrations that multiply every engineer's impact, using tools like Claude Code, Cursor, and GitHub Copilot.
What You'll Own
  • Architect the platform: Architect, design, and develop features and services for our travel platform as a technical leader on a full-stack product team.
  • Drive agentic adoption: Standardize agentic coding tools across engineering teams, establishing best practices, prompt libraries, and workflows that amplify productivity org-wide.
  • Set the quality bar: Review and validate AI-generated code for correctness, security, performance, and maintainability, setting the standard across teams.
  • Modernize at scale: Revitalize aging services through refactoring, migration, and cloud-native distributed design.
  • Strategize agentic workflows: Define patterns and platforms that automate testing, documentation, code-review triage, and deployment checks at scale.
  • Architect MCP integrations: Design Model Context Protocol integrations that connect AI agents to internal tools, data, and platform services across the development lifecycle.
  • Lead distributed systems: Lead improvements to development and operations of an increasingly distributed architecture across cloud platforms.
  • Protect member trust: Safeguard the privacy and security of members' sensitive data with our Risk and Security teams.
  • Increase velocity: Introduce processes that help us ship quicker, learn sooner, and isolate impact, and help establish and meet system SLOs.
  • Mentor across teams: Guide engineers on AI-assisted development, prompt engineering, and agentic workflow design.

What You'll Bring
  • 8+ years of full-stack development and architectural experience building web applications and services.
  • Expert proficiency using AI coding agents such as Claude Code, Cursor, or GitHub Copilot in professional workflows.
  • Strong proficiency in two or more of TypeScript/JavaScript, Python, or C#/.NET.
  • Deep experience with modern frontend frameworks such as React, Next.js, Vue, or Angular.
  • A proven track record architecting and delivering cloud-native solutions on AWS, Azure, or GCP.
  • Extensive experience with RESTful API design and microservices architecture.
  • Deep understanding of the Model Context Protocol (MCP) and experience architecting MCP server ecosystems.
  • Experience with containerization and orchestration (Docker, Kubernetes) and CI/CD pipelines.
  • A track record of leading technical designs, mentoring engineers across teams, and raising engineering maturity.
  • A formal CS degree is a plus, not a requirement. Depth of engineering knowledge matters most.
